Mapping collective human activity in an urban environment based on mobile phone data

Abstract: Identifying and characterizing variations of human activity -specifically changes in intensity and similarity -in urban environments provide insights into the social component of those eminently complex systems. Using large volumes of usergenerated mobile phone data, we derive mobile communication profiles that we use as a proxy for the collective human activity.
